Searched refs:thenComparing (Results 1 - 7 of 7) sorted by relevance

/openjdk10/jdk/src/java.base/share/classes/java/util/
H A DComparator.java203 * .thenComparing(String.CASE_INSENSITIVE_ORDER);
213 default Comparator<T> thenComparing(Comparator<? super T> other) { method in interface:Comparator
226 * thenComparing(comparing(keyExtractor, cmp))}.
235 * @see #thenComparing(Comparator)
238 default <U> Comparator<T> thenComparing( method in interface:Comparator
242 return thenComparing(comparing(keyExtractor, keyComparator));
250 * thenComparing(comparing(keyExtractor))}.
259 * @see #thenComparing(Comparator)
262 default <U extends Comparable<? super U>> Comparator<T> thenComparing( method in interface:Comparator
265 return thenComparing(comparin
[all...]
H A DComparators.java88 public Comparator<T> thenComparing(Comparator<? super T> other) { method in class:Comparators.NullComparator
90 return new NullComparator<>(nullFirst, real == null ? other : real.thenComparing(other));
/openjdk10/jdk/test/java/util/Comparator/
H A DTypeTest.java107 // Comparator<Manager> cmp = Employee.C.thenComparing(Person.C);
108 Comparator<Employee> cmp = Employee.C.thenComparing(Person.C);
109 assertOrder(m1, m2, Employee.C.thenComparing(Person.C));
127 .thenComparing(Department::getManager, Employee.C);
131 .thenComparing(Department::getManager, Manager.C);
135 .thenComparing(Department::getManager, Person.C);
H A DBasicTest.java218 // thenComparing(Comparator)
219 assertComparison(cmp.thenComparing(cmp2), people[0], people[1]);
220 assertComparison(cmp.thenComparing(cmp2), people[4], people[0]);
221 // thenComparing(Function)
222 assertComparison(cmp.thenComparing(People::getLastName), people[0], people[1]);
223 assertComparison(cmp.thenComparing(People::getLastName), people[4], people[0]);
224 // thenComparing(ToIntFunction)
227 // thenComparing(ToLongFunction)
230 // thenComparing(ToDoubleFunction)
239 .thenComparing(Peopl
[all...]
/openjdk10/jdk/test/java/util/Map/
H A DEntryComparators.java68 Comparator<Map.Entry<K, V>> cmp = ck.thenComparing(cv);
77 cmp = cv.thenComparing(ck);
120 Comparator<People> cmp = cmp1.thenComparing(cmp2);
/openjdk10/langtools/src/jdk.jdeps/share/classes/com/sun/tools/jdeps/
H A DAnalyzer.java192 .thenComparing(Dep::target))
H A DJdepsTask.java849 .thenComparing(this::toInversePath);

Completed in 82 milliseconds